About 1 in 5 Houston adults is considered illiterate, experiencing difficulty in completing tasks such as filling out job applications. The goal of the Houston Adult Literacy Project is to build the capacity of adult education and literacy organizations in Houston, which support low-income, low literacy adult learners to help them to obtain and grow the skills they need to become self-sufficient and improve their quality of life. The Alliance is a leading nonprofit comprised of an amazing team that hails from 26 countries and speaks over 20 languages. The Alliance welcomes and empowers refugees, immigrants, and underserved residents who face financial, educational, health, language, or cultural barriers to realizing their dreams. The Alliance’s Development Office encompasses a variety of programs that provides a range of domestic services for newly-arrived refugees to help them to adjust to their new lives in Houston. ** This position is included with a rental assistance program that is offered by The Alliance for VISTA Members. **
